 Russell Crowe is an actor who is also a film producer and musician who has an estimated net value of $120 million dollars. While Crowe started his career in television and film, his Oscar Award-winning performance of Maximus Decimus Meridius (2000's "Gladiator") has made him an international star. Crowe also received praise for his performances in the films "The Insider", "A Beautiful Mind," or "Cinderella Man." Russell was a part of the Russell Crowe and the Ordinary Fear of God bands 30 Odd Foot of Grunts and Russell Crowe & the Ordinary Fear of God. He also co-owned South Sydney Rabbitohs, which is an National Rugby League club. Russell Ira Crowe was born in Wellington, New Zealand, on the 7th of April 1964. Jocelyn and John were both caterers for film sets. John was also a manager at an hotel. Russell's maternal grandfather was a cinematographer. Russell also has ties to three cricket players, his relatives Jeff Crowe, Martin Crowe and his Uncle Dave Crowe. The family relocated to Sydney, Australia, when Russell was four years old. Russell made his acting debut in an episode of "Spyforce" in 1972 (the show's producer was Jocelyn's godfather). Crowe was a student at Vaucluse Public School as well as Sydney Boys High School before his family returned to New Zealand when he was 14.
